Increased endothelin excretion in rats with renal failure induced by partial nephrectomy.

Abstract

1. Six weeks following partial nephrectomy in rats, significant increases in serum urea nitrogen and serum creatinine concentration and a significant decrease in creatinine clearance were observed. 2. Measurement of systolic blood pressure by tail plethysmography indicated that animals that had undergone partial nephrectomy were hypertensive. 3. Compared to sham-operated animals, there were 4 fold increases in both urinary protein excretion and urinary endothelin excretion. 4. There was a significant correlation between urinary protein and urinary endothelin excretion (r = 0.77). There was also a correlation (r = 0.65) between urinary endothelin excretion and systolic blood pressure. 5. Plasma endothelin concentrations were not different in sham-operated and partially nephrectomized rats. 6. The data indicate that there is an increased renal endothelin production in rats with chronic renal failure.
